The Mitsubishi Fuso Super Great, first introduced in 1996, celebrates its 30th anniversary this year. For three decades, the Super Great has evolved alongside the logistics industry, adapting to new challenges while raising the bar for environmental performance, safety, and driver comfort.
Here, we look back at the journey of the Super Great and the milestones that have shaped its legacy.

The Super Great was launched as the successor to “The Great.” It introduced several groundbreaking features for its time:
•Japan’s first discharge (HID) headlamps
•A low-floor 4-axle configuration with equally sized wheels
Additionally, it adopted the distinctive “Round Cubic Style” and a newly developed cab, establishing a design language that would continue to evolve for generations to come.
Further enhancements followed in 2000, including the introduction of full air-suspension models
•New 6M70 engine
•Improved braking performance
To comply with emissions regulations, the powertrain also underwent a major transition—from V8 engines to inline 6-cylinder turbocharged engines—marking a significant evolution of the lineup. By 2005, in response to new short-term emissions regulations, all models had been standardized to inline 6-cylinder turbo engines.
A major facelift in 2007 brought a completely redesigned front appearance. At the same time, advanced technologies were introduced, including:
•Urea SCR system
•2-pedal transmission “INOMAT-II”
These innovations contributed to the model receiving the 2007 Good Design Award, recognizing not only its performance but also its design excellence.
In 2010, the newly developed 6R10 engine was introduced, meeting post-New Long-Term emissions regulations.
In 2014, additional advancements included:
•Adoption of an asymmetric turbocharger
•Achieving +5% over fuel efficiency standards across all models
The exterior design also evolved, with blue and silver accents added to elements such as the grille, bumper, lamp bezels, and mirrors—reflecting a balance between functionality and design.
A major milestone came in 2017 with the first full model change in 21 years.
•New engines (10.7L 6R20 and 7.7L 6S10)
•New 12-speed AMT “ShiftPilot”
•Standard-equipped telematics system “Truckonnect”
Together, these advancements ushered in the era of connected trucks.
In 2019, the Super Great became the first commercial vehicle in Japan to feature Level 2 automated driving technology with Active Drive Assist. The 2021 update included the following features:
•Active Drive Assist 2
•Emergency Stop Assist
•Active Side Guard Assist
These enhancements significantly improved safety for both drivers and surrounding road users.

A full model change was carried out in 2023 for the first time in six years.
Key updates included:
•New 12.8L 6R30 engine
•Compliance with the 2025 heavy-duty vehicle fuel efficiency standards (JH25 mode)
•Addition of the Super High Roof
Together, these enhancements advanced power, environmental performance, and cabin comfort. The lineup was also expanded to meet diverse transportation needs, including a model with a 20-ton fifth-wheel load and 530 horsepower.
